In 2006, on the streets of Kiev, Ukraine, a man appeared seemingly out of nowhere. Confused, dressed in outdated clothing, and holding an old-fashioned camera, he identified himself as Sergei Ponomarenko — and claimed to be from the year 1958. According to reports, he was detained by authorities for his strange behaviour and lack of modern documentation. Things only got stranger from there.
When his film roll was developed, the photos allegedly showed 1950s-era Kiev with astonishing clarity — photos he couldn’t possibly have taken if he were a modern-day hoaxer. Moreover, some witnesses and documents suggested that Ponomarenko disappeared mysteriously after his brief detainment, further fuelling speculation. Some even claim he reappeared decades later, looking only slightly older, still confused, and still claiming he had only just arrived.

As mankind continues to bring science fiction to life, people are now convinced that a photo from the 1940s is ‘proof’ that time travel has been achieved.
The picture in question is from 1941 and it details a line of children all dressed smartly and queuing up outside a cinema in Chicago, while one boy gripped onto what some are suggesting is an iPad.
Of course, the first iPad was invented by Apple some 69 years later in 2010 – although the device he’s gripping onto has a slightly different finish to it, so it would have been one of the later generations… if it is indeed a tablet.

Anyway, an old photo posted to Reddit has sparked a time travel debate with social media users having been left in shock by the picture, which was taken by Edwin Rosskam.
While it’s fascinating to see how youngsters were living at a time when World War II was taking place, there is one kid in particular everyone on Reddit is talking about.

A boy on the far-right of the shot has many talking, with some believing he may have an iPad in his hand.
I mean, this is impossible. The first iPad was released in 2010, so there can only be one explanation, according to Reddit users… time travel.
“iPad carrying movie goes, all the way to the right,” one user wrote, while another claimed the photo provides ‘proof of time travel’.
